About Thomas Andl

Thomas Andl is a scholar working on Molecular Biology, Cell Biology, Urology, Cancer Research and Dermatology, having authored 83 papers that have together received 7.6k indexed citations. Recurring topics across this work include Hair Growth and Disorders (23 papers), Wnt/β-catenin signaling in development and cancer (17 papers), MicroRNA in disease regulation (12 papers), Skin and Cellular Biology Research (11 papers), Cancer and Skin Lesions (10 papers), Cancer-related molecular mechanisms research (9 papers), Cancer-related gene regulation (8 papers) and Cancer Cells and Metastasis (6 papers). The work is most often cited by research in Urology (2.2k citations), Dermatology (974 citations), Cell Biology (1.5k citations), Rehabilitation (532 citations) and Cancer Research (1.1k citations). Thomas Andl has collaborated with scholars based in United States, Germany and Japan. Frequent co-authors include Sarah E. Millar, Yuhang Zhang, Edward E. Morrisey, Mayumi Ito, George Cotsarelis, Linli Zhou, Noori Kim, Zaixin Yang, Min Lü and Stefano Piccolo. Their work appears in journals such as Development, International Journal of Molecular Sciences, Scientific Reports, Experimental Dermatology and PLoS ONE.
